A Federal Communications Commission order requires service providers to get the auto-directing of calls up and running no later than July 2022. That measure, which President Donald Trump signed into law in October, will set up 9-8-8 as a three-digit number to access support resources. More recently, Congress came together to make the National Suicide Prevention Lifeline more easily accessible to those in need. “I didn’t volunteer to be a champion of this issue, but it arose out of the personal experience of being a parent who lost a child to mental illness and suicide,” Smith said in 2004, in one of the most emotional Senate floor speeches in memory. Smith, R-Ore., lost his son Garrett Lee Smith in 2003, he led enactment of landmark legislation that established the Garrett Lee Smith Memorial Suicide Prevention Program, providing grants to state and tribal governments for youth suicide prevention and early intervention efforts across the country.
